Larry Robbins
Larry Robbins is a bluegrass bassist from Montgomery County, Maryland, known for his years with the Johnson Mountain Boys during the band's most active period.
- Grew up in Montgomery County, Maryland, and played in a country-gospel band and the group Bluegrass Image before turning to bluegrass full time.
- Was the bassist for the Johnson Mountain Boys from 1979 to 1986, the years of the band's heaviest touring and recording.
- Recorded and performed with the Johnson Mountain Boys backing Hazel Dickens, including on her album “A Few Old Memories.”
- Was succeeded in the Johnson Mountain Boys by bassist Marshall Wilborn in 1986.
- The Johnson Mountain Boys were later inducted into the Bluegrass Music Hall of Fame.
